Serial entrepreneur Abdulla Kudrath is a self-made millionaire who turned his passion for emergency medicine into a $1.9 million a month revenue across his more than a dozen businesses. He shares the strategies he’s used to achieve this success in this interview.

Abdulla grew up as a first-generation American in a working class neighborhood of New Jersey. Like many people, Abdulla didn’t have a clear path for his future when he graduated high school. He did well in school and went to college for computer science, but he wasn’t passionate about that career choice–and it showed. He was a self-described “slacker” who put as much energy into playing video games as he did into his studies.

All of that changed when he nearly failed out of school. That served as a wake-up call for him to find his passion and what truly brought him happiness, principles that have guided his entrepreneurial ventures since. He shifted from computer science to medicine and got the opportunity to travel to the Amazon, sparking a new passion for biology that led him to become an emergency room doctor. That laid the foundation for his future successes, both within the medical field and in other areas where he’s passionate, like collecting cars.

Following his heart and passions helped Abdulla achieve his full potential, but that doesn’t mean his journey was easy. In this interview, we’ll hear the struggles he went through and the challenges he overcame, along with the sacrifices he had to make to get to where he is today. He’ll also share his advice for people who want to become millionaires, and why following your heart and passion is a better way to go about it than focusing on the money.
